Inflation pushes up the thresholds each year and these charts represent the new tax brackets for 2008.
| Tax rate |
Single filers |
Married filing jointly |
| 10 percent |
up to $8,025 |
up to $16,050 |
| 15 percent |
$8,026-$32,550 |
$16,051-$65,100 |
| 25 percent |
$32,551-$78,850 |
$65,101-$131,450 |
| 28 percent |
$78,851-$164-550 |
$131,451-$200,300 |
| 33 percent |
$164,551-$357,700 |
$200,301-357,700 |
| 35 percent |
$357,701 or more |
$357,701 or more |
| Tax rate |
Head of household |
Married filing separately |
| 10 percent |
up to $11,450 |
up to $8,025 |
| 15 percent |
$11,451-$43,650 |
$8,026-$32,550 |
| 25 percent |
$43,651-$112,650 |
$32,551-$65,725 |
| 28 percent |
$112,651-$182,400 |
$65,726-$100,150 |
| 33 percent |
$182,401-$357,700 |
$100,151-$178,850 |
35 percent |
$357,701 or more |
$178,851 or more |
